Aluminium panels are made in various types: They can be "All-Aluminium" (meaning the panel could simply be an aluminum slab or a sheet of large thickness) or they could be composite panels where aluminum sheets are combined with other materials such as plastics, mineral fibers, or hard foam.

Technically speaking, most aluminum sheets that are used in making panels are actually aluminum alloys (which means that some other metals in very small amounts have been added to the aluminum in order to strengthen it and allow it to acquire important properties). Different alloys have different aluminum content.

To calculate how much aluminum is present in a panel, you would first need to identify your Alloy, and then have 3 pieces of information:

1. The Density of your aluminum alloy.

2. The Thickness of your aluminum panel.

3. The Surface Area of your aluminum panel.

For example, take a 1m2 panel of aluminum of alloy AA3003 and a thickness of 1.0mm. To calculate the amount of aluminum (by weight) in that panel, we use the above 3 pieces of information as follows:

Weight of Aluminium = Density x (Thickness x Length x Width)

Tip: Make sure that the units of measurement all match.

(e.g. If you use "Kg." for Weight, then make sure you convert "millimeters-mm" to "meters-m" before applying the formula).

Can you use aluminum service cable to feed a sub panel?

Yes, as long as it has the necessary ampacity for the load and is properly fastened at each terminal. For example, we have a 4/0 aluminum cable feeding our 200 A subpanel 120 feet away.


What size aluminum ser cable needed for 100 amp sub panel?

For a 100 amp sub panel, you would typically need a 2-2-2-4 aluminum SER cable. This cable consists of three insulated conductors (two hot and one neutral) and one bare ground wire. It is important to always consult your local electrical code and a qualified electrician to ensure you have the correct size and type of cable for your specific installation.


What wire size for 100 amp sub panel 250 ft from main panel?

For a 100 amp sub panel located 250 ft from the main panel, you would typically need to use 3/0 aluminum wire or 2/0 copper wire to ensure efficient power transmission and voltage drop within acceptable limits. It is recommended to consult with a licensed electrician to ensure the appropriate wire size and materials are used for your specific setup.

How much heat can aluminum withstand?

That depends on what you are trying to ask.First point is that heat is energy in transit - if it isn't moving from one place to another it's technically not heat. Thermal energy - the energy held by a mass due to temperature is a better term, but even that is a bit ambiguous.With that in mind...if you mean how much energy can be stored as thermal energy by aluminum, you would have to look up the heat capacity - which is approximately 0.91 kJ/kg K (the exact value depending on temperature and purity of the aluminum)If you mean how much resistance aluminum foil can provide to the transfer of heat, that would depend on the temperature gradient and how shiny the aluminum was - shiny aluminum will reflect more heat that dull/burnished aluminum surfaces.
